Under direction of the Director of Operations, the production supervisor position is responsible for supervising shop employees in a manufacturing and assembly environment.

The supervisor oversees the manufacturing of products by organizing and monitoring work flow. This position plans and assigns work, implements policies and operating procedures, and recommends improvements in production methods, equipment, and working conditions.

Swing Shift

The swing shift supervisor may be asked to oversee numerous departments at once. A general knowledge of each area is beneficial.

This may include fabrication, machining, powder coating, welding, and assembly of heavy machinery.

Responsibilities

Communicates job expectations to staff by monitoring, appraising job results, coaching, and disciplining employees, while enforcing systems, policies, and procedures.

Maintains professional and technical knowledge by attending Itochu educational workshops and reviewing state-of-the-art and best practices.

Maintains work flow by monitoring steps of the process, observing control points and equipment, monitoring personnel and resources, implementing cost reductions, correct quality issues, and focus on error-proofing manufacturing processes.

Evaluates production plan by scheduling and assigning personnel, establishing priorities, monitoring progress, and reporting important results of the shift production to the Director of Operations.

Manage department performance including cross training and monitoring units produced. Defines the daily goal and monitors progress during the shift.

Evaluates systems and procedures by analyzing operating needs, and budgetary and personnel requirements.

Maintains safe and clean work environment by educating and directing personnel on the use of all control points, equipment, and resources;

maintaining compliance with established policies and procedures.

Assists Environmental Health & Safety Manager to inspect machines and equipment to ensure specific operational performance and optimum utilization.

Perform accident investigations and work with EHS Manger to define corrective actions plans.

Balance quality, productivity, cost, safety and morale to achieve positive results in all areas. Work to continuously improve in all areas.

Track absenteeism and timekeeping and report employee issues. Create corrective actions if necessary.

Resolves worker grievances or submits unsettled grievances to Human Resources Manager for action.

Safely operates a hoist and forklift as needed.

Performs other duties that may be assigned.

Supervisory Responsibilities

Manage direct reports such as Department Leads and employees in all departments. Responsible for the overall direction, coordination, and evaluation of these lines.

Carries out supervisory responsibilities in accordance with the organization's policies and applicable laws. Responsibilities include interviewing, training employees, planning, assigning, and directing work.

The supervisor appraises performance, rewards and disciplines employees, while addressing complaints and resolving problems.
